行业资讯

云端部署应用全攻略

在云端轻松部署应用已成为现代技术开发中的关键步骤。本文详细介绍了从选择合适的云服务提供商到成功安装和部署应用程序的全过程,帮助开发者快速上手,享受云计算带来的便捷与高效。

在数字化转型的时代浪潮中,越来越多的企业选择利用云计算服务来构建其业务平台,而其中,云服务器因其强大的计算能力和灵活的扩展性,成为企业部署应用程序的理想选择,本文将详细介绍如何在阿里云这样的云服务器平台上成功安装并运行您的应用程序。

一、选择合适的云服务器

您需要根据自己的需求选择合适的云服务器,阿里云提供了多种类型的云服务器,包括但不限于通用型、内存优化型和GPU加速型等,每种类型都有不同的性能特点及价格区间,为了保证应用的稳定运行,建议根据实际负载情况选择具有足够资源的实例类型。

二、获取必要的工具和环境

在安装应用之前,确保已经获取了所有必要的开发工具和库文件,这些可能包括Java开发工具包(JDK)、Python解释器、Node.js等,也需要提前配置好操作系统环境变量,以便后续编译安装过程中能够正确找到所需的工具。

三、下载与准备应用程序源码

从官方网站或GitHub等开源平台上获取所需的应用程序源代码,并进行相应的解压和整理工作,确保源代码文件已准备好用于后续编译安装。

四、编译安装应用

进入应用程序源代码所在的目录后,执行相应的编译命令以生成可执行文件或动态链接库,这一步骤通常依赖于具体的编程语言及框架,对于Java应用,可能需要使用Maven或Gradle构建工具;对于Python应用,则可能需要pip安装第三方库,务必遵循官方文档中的指导原则进行操作。

五、设置系统服务或启动脚本

为了便于管理和监控应用进程,建议将它配置为系统服务或创建一个简单的启动脚本,这样,在系统重启后也能自动启动应用,具体实现方式会因使用的操作系统不同而有所差异,但大体上都是通过编辑配置文件或调用特定命令来完成。

六、配置数据库连接信息

大多数现代应用程序都会涉及到数据库的使用,在安装过程中还需要配置好数据库连接的相关参数,如用户名、密码以及数据库地址等信息,确保所有敏感数据都经过适当加密处理,以保障系统的安全。

七、部署到生产环境

当测试阶段一切顺利后,就可以将应用部署到生产环境了,这一步骤通常需要在多个服务器之间进行复制或者迁移,以保证应用的高可用性和可靠性,阿里云提供了便捷的数据同步服务,方便用户轻松实现这一目标。

通过以上步骤,您可以较为顺利地将应用程序部署到阿里云提供的云服务器上,需要注意的是,在整个过程中要时刻关注服务器的状态信息,并及时采取相应措施解决问题,希望本文对您有所帮助,也欢迎您分享更多关于云服务器部署经验!


加入我们 立即开启您的云服务之旅

优秀的云计算服务即刻部署 无论您是小型企业还是大型企业 都可以为您提供最好的定制解决方案

免费注册